## Service Accounts for Catalogue Import

External plugins integrating with the Shelfwright catalogue importer must authenticate as a registered service account rather than a personal login. Each account is scoped to a single library tenant and permits batch record submission only. For sandbox testing against the Marrowgate tenant, plugins should present the key below.

gateway credential: kto3_qfe

Subject: Regional Sales Review — Handover to Incoming Director

Team, ahead of Director Halloway's arrival, a brief summary: the Westmarch region finished 6% above target, while Carrowdale lagged on renewals. Pipeline quality has improved since the new qualification rules took effect. A full account-by-account review is scheduled for her first fortnight. Please send any open items to me by Friday. The confidential note on our business plans follows below.

board note of bawep-tajef: Queniusek Systems plans to raise the Quenvan list price by 53.1 percent in March. The pricing group signed off on a budget of $176.4 million for Project Drueth. The renewal with Casionix Partners closes at $142.5 million a year, 8.3 percent below the last contract. Project Fraax slips by six weeks because of the tooling delay.

TICKET-4412: Intermittent connection failures during nightly cron runs. We're moving the Quillbarn scheduled jobs to the Fennick workflow engine, which pools connections instead of opening fresh ones per run. This should eliminate the timeout spikes seen since the Marlowe release. For the cutover, the engine needs the primary reporting database. The target instance is as follows.

replica DSN, yahog-kawig: redis://istox_svc:um@db-8a67.halixforge.test:5432/frawyn

## Ownership

The KioskGuard watchdog keeps the Brightstall kiosk app alive on all in-store units. It restarts the renderer if the heartbeat file goes stale for more than 20 seconds and logs each restart to the local journal. New team members should not modify the restart thresholds without a design note, since field units in the Verlow pilot stores depend on the current timing. Questions about alerting, threshold changes, or the journal format go through one person. The current owner of the watchdog is listed below.

named custodian: Brivan Eliath Quenox Frador